summaryrefslogtreecommitdiff
path: root/src/shader_recompiler/backend/glasm/reg_alloc.cpp (follow)
Commit message (Expand)AuthorAgeFilesLines
* general: Convert source file copyright comments over to SPDXGravatar Morph2022-04-231-3/+2
* shader_recompiler: Reduce unused includesGravatar ameerj2022-03-201-3/+0
* shader_recompiler: Adjust emit_context includesGravatar ameerj2021-12-051-1/+1
* glasm: Remove unnecessary value typesGravatar ReinUsesLisp2021-07-221-4/+4
* glasm: Catch more register leaksGravatar ReinUsesLisp2021-07-221-4/+24
* glasm: Do not alias ConditionRef for nowGravatar ReinUsesLisp2021-07-221-1/+0
* shader: Read branch conditions from an instructionGravatar ReinUsesLisp2021-07-221-0/+1
* glasm: Fix aliased bitcasts ref countingGravatar ReinUsesLisp2021-07-221-7/+32
* glasm: Add Void type to GLASM valuesGravatar ReinUsesLisp2021-07-221-0/+3
* glasm: Fix register allocation when moving immediate on GLASMGravatar ReinUsesLisp2021-07-221-30/+41
* glasm: Add conversion instructions to GLASMGravatar ReinUsesLisp2021-07-221-0/+4
* glasm: Initial GLASM fp64 supportGravatar ReinUsesLisp2021-07-221-19/+47
* glasm: Make GLASM aware of typesGravatar ReinUsesLisp2021-07-221-27/+35
* glasm: Implement more logical opsGravatar ameerj2021-07-221-1/+1
* glasm: Use BitField instead of C bitfieldsGravatar ReinUsesLisp2021-07-221-5/+5
* glasm: Changes to GLASM register allocator and emit contextGravatar ReinUsesLisp2021-07-221-16/+21
* glasm: Add GLASM backend infrastructureGravatar ReinUsesLisp2021-07-221-0/+82